If you’ve been searching for a comforting, creamy soup that doesn’t compromise on flavor or health, look no further than this delightful Vegan Cauliflower Soup Recipe. It’s utterly satisfying, completely dairy-free, and comes together with such simple ingredients that your kitchen will feel like a cozy haven in no time. This soup strikes the perfect balance between light and indulgent, making it an ideal meal for any day when you crave something warm, nourishing, and effortlessly delicious.

Ingredients You’ll Need

The image shows a metal baking tray filled with multiple pieces of roasted cauliflower. The cauliflower pieces have a golden brown color with some darker, crispier spots, indicating they are roasted well. The texture of the florets is slightly rough with some charred edges, and they are spread out evenly on the tray. The tray sits on a white marbled surface. Photo taken with an iphone --ar 4:5 --v 7

Nothing complicated here—just a handful of wholesome, natural ingredients that each play a crucial role in building layers of flavor and creating that luscious texture. From the mild sweetness of cauliflower to the gentle creaminess of coconut milk, every ingredient shines through beautifully.

  • Cauliflower: The star vegetable, providing a mild, nutty base and velvety texture when blended.
  • Onion: Adds a subtle depth and natural sweetness that enhances the overall flavor profile.
  • Vegetable broth: Creates a savory liquid backdrop that brings all ingredients together.
  • Coconut milk: Infuses creamy richness while keeping the soup completely dairy-free.
  • Olive oil: For sautéing the onions gently, adding a hint of fruitiness and smoothness.
  • Salt and pepper: Essential seasonings to elevate the taste just right without overpowering.

How to Make Vegan Cauliflower Soup Recipe

Step 1: Sauté the Onions

Start by heating the olive oil in a large pot over medium heat. Toss in the diced onions and sauté them gently for about 3 minutes until they become soft and translucent. This step is key to unlocking the onions’ natural sweetness, which forms the flavor foundation for the entire soup.

Step 2: Cook the Cauliflower

Add the chopped cauliflower to the pot along with the vegetable broth. Bring everything to a gentle simmer and let it cook for 10 to 12 minutes, until the cauliflower is tender and perfectly soft. This is where the soup starts to transform, with the cauliflower absorbing the savory broth for incredible taste.

Step 3: Blend Until Smooth

Carefully transfer the cooked mixture to a blender, or use an immersion blender right in the pot, and blend until silky smooth. The magic happens here as the cauliflower becomes a creamy base, inviting the soup to take on that indulgent texture everyone loves.

Step 4: Stir in Coconut Milk and Reheat

Pour in the coconut milk and stir it through the pureed soup, adding a delightful richness. Return the pot to the stove and reheat gently, making sure to keep the soup warm without boiling, preserving that silky consistency and subtle coconut aroma.

How to Serve Vegan Cauliflower Soup Recipe

A round pan filled with creamy light yellow soup sits on a white marbled surface. Two roasted cauliflower pieces with browned edges float in the center of the smooth soup, sprinkled with small green herb bits. A metal spoon rests inside the pan, with its handle pointing toward the front right. In the background, blurred light-colored crackers and a brown cloth are visible. Photo taken with an iphone --ar 4:5 --v 7

Garnishes

While the soup is wonderful on its own, adding garnishes really takes it to the next level. Try toasting almonds for a crunchy contrast or sprinkle fresh herbs like parsley or chives to add a pop of color and freshness. These little touches bring texture and visual appeal, making every spoonful a joy.

Side Dishes

This soup is satisfying enough to stand on its own, but pairing it with crusty gluten-free bread, a bright green salad, or even roasted vegetables creates a more complete and balanced meal. The gentle flavors of the soup complement these sides beautifully without overwhelming them.

Creative Ways to Present

For a fun twist, serve the soup in individual bread bowls for an inviting, rustic look. Or drizzle a swirl of extra coconut milk or a spoonful of pesto on top before serving to add an elegant flourish. Presentation is a fantastic way to impress guests or simply treat yourself to a restaurant-quality experience at home.

Make Ahead and Storage

Storing Leftovers

Once cooled to room temperature, store any leftover soup in an airtight container in the refrigerator. It will stay fresh for about 3 to 4 days, making it perfect for quick lunches or easy dinner reheats during the week.

Freezing

This Vegan Cauliflower Soup Recipe freezes beautifully. Pour the cooled soup into freezer-safe containers, leaving a bit of headroom for expansion. It can be stored in the freezer for up to 3 months without losing its delicious flavor or creamy texture.

Reheating

When ready to enjoy your leftovers, thaw the soup overnight in the fridge if frozen. Reheat gently over low to medium heat, stirring occasionally to prevent sticking. If it thickens too much, add a splash of vegetable broth or water to loosen it back up.

FAQs

Can I use a different type of milk instead of coconut milk?

Absolutely! While coconut milk adds a rich, slightly sweet creaminess ideal for this soup, you can substitute it with other plant-based milks like almond or cashew milk. Just keep in mind that the flavor and texture may vary slightly.

Is this soup suitable for low-carb diets?

Yes, cauliflower is naturally low in carbohydrates, making this soup a great option for anyone following a low-carb or keto-friendly diet. Plus, it’s filling and nutrient-dense, which helps keep you satisfied.

Can I make this soup in a slow cooker?

Definitely! Simply sauté the onions first, then add all ingredients (except coconut milk) to your slow cooker. Cook on low for 4–6 hours or until the cauliflower is tender. Blend and stir in coconut milk before serving.

What can I use to garnish if I’m allergic to nuts?

If nuts are off-limits, fresh herbs like parsley, thyme, or cilantro make wonderful garnishes. You can also drizzle extra virgin olive oil or sprinkle roasted seeds such as pumpkin or sunflower for added texture.

How thick is this soup? Can I adjust the consistency?

This soup is creamy but still pourable, perfect for a comforting meal. If you prefer it thinner, simply add more vegetable broth while blending. For a thicker version, reduce the broth slightly or add a small potato during cooking for extra body.

Final Thoughts

You really can’t go wrong with this Vegan Cauliflower Soup Recipe. It’s quick, easy, and wonderfully comforting without relying on any dairy or complicated ingredients. Whether you’re looking for a healthy weeknight dinner or a cozy weekend treat, this soup is sure to become a favorite in your recipe rotation. Give it a try—you’ll be amazed at how simple ingredients can create something so delicious and satisfying.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Vegan Cauliflower Soup Recipe

Vegan Cauliflower Soup Recipe


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

3.8 from 72 reviews

  • Author: Sara
  • Total Time: 20 minutes
  • Yield: 4 servings
  • Diet: Vegan

Description

This vegan cauliflower soup is a creamy, comforting, and dairy-free dish that’s light yet indulgent. Perfect as a simple meal for those seeking wholesome, plant-based comfort food, it combines tender cauliflower, sautéed onions, and coconut milk to create a smooth and flavorful soup that’s quick and easy to prepare.


Ingredients

Vegetables

  • 1 medium cauliflower, chopped
  • 1 onion, diced

Liquids

  • 3 cups vegetable broth
  • ½ cup coconut milk
  • 1 tbsp olive oil

Seasoning

  • Salt & pepper, to taste


Instructions

  1. Sauté Onion: Heat the olive oil in a large pot over medium heat. Add the diced onion and sauté for about 3 minutes until the onion is translucent and fragrant, which brings out its sweetness and forms the base of the soup.
  2. Add Cauliflower and Broth: Add the chopped cauliflower to the pot, then pour in the vegetable broth. Increase the heat slightly and bring to a simmer. Let it cook uncovered for 10 to 12 minutes, or until the cauliflower is tender and easily pierced with a fork.
  3. Blend the Soup: Using an immersion blender or carefully transferring the soup into a blender in batches, blend the soup until it is completely smooth and creamy, ensuring there are no lumps left.
  4. Stir in Coconut Milk and Reheat: Return the blended soup to the pot if needed. Stir in the coconut milk for richness and creaminess. Reheat gently over low heat, adjusting seasoning with salt and pepper to taste. Serve warm.

Notes

  • For added texture and flavor, top the soup with toasted almonds.
  • Fresh herbs such as parsley or chives make a bright, fresh garnish.
  • This soup can be stored in the refrigerator for up to 3 days and reheated on the stovetop.
  • Adjust thickness by adding more vegetable broth or coconut milk as desired.
  • Prep Time: 5 minutes
  • Cook Time: 15 minutes
  • Category: Soup
  • Method: Blending
  • Cuisine: American

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star